
body {
  margin: 0;
  padding: 0;


}

h1 {
  font-size: 30px;
  font-family: 黑体 Serif;
}

h2 {
  font-size: 19px;
  color: white;
  font-family: 黑体;

}

h3 {
  font-weight: normal;
  font-size: 17px;
  color: black;
}

/*主体*/
.all {
  max-width: 100%;
  /*height: 4051px;*/
  height: 100%;
  margin-left: auto;
  margin-right: auto;
  min-width: 1200px;
}
/********************************************/
.navbar {
  margin-bottom: 0;
  background: white;
  border: 1px solid white;
}

.navbar-brand {
  padding: 3px;
}

.navbar-nav {
  width: 700px;
  height: 40px;
  padding: 0;
  margin-left: 60px;
}

.navbar-default .navbar-nav > .active > a {
  font-size: 15px;
  background-color: transparent;
}

.navbar-default .navbar-nav > li > a {
  padding: 15px;
  font-size: 15px;
  margin-left: 15px;
}

.navbar-default .navbar-nav > .active > a:focus {

}

/********************************************/

.one-logo {
  margin-top: -5px;
}

.logo2 {

  width: 314px;
  height: 48px;
  float: left;
  margin-top: 17px;
}

.navigation-button {

  line-height: 80px;
  width: 669px;
  height: 80px;
  float: left;

}

.first-font {
  margin-left: 90px;
}

.two-font {
  margin-left: 5px;
}

/*超链接*/

a {
  font-size: 14px;
  text-decoration: none;
  color: #666666;
}

.banner {
  padding-top: 80px;
  width: 1906px;
  height: 301px;
}

.one {

  margin: 0;
  height: 303px;

}
.title {
  width: 1200px;
  margin-right: auto;
  margin-left: auto;
}

.link-left {
  width: 120px;
  height: 3px;
  background: blue;
}

.link-right {
  width: 100%;
  height: 1px;
  background: #0f0f0f;
}
.two {
  margin: 0;
  width: 100%;
  height: 100%;
  background-color: #F6F6F6;
}
.two-main{
  width: 1200px;
  height: 320px;
  margin-left: auto;
  margin-right: auto;

}

.text-right-pic {
  float: right;
  width: 450px;
  height: 255px;
  margin-top: 20px;
  margin-right: 40px;

}

.intro {
  font-size: 18px;
  width:695px;
  height: 15%;
  text-align: left;
  margin-top:60px;
  float: left;
  line-height: 30px;
}




.banner {
  margin: 0;
  width: 100%;
  height: 448px;
}

.three{
  width: 100%;
  height:20%;
  background-color: #F6F6F6;
  float: left;

}
.three-main{
  width:1200px;
  height: 100%;
  margin-left: auto;
  margin-right: auto;

}


/*左边部分*/
.two-up-left-div {
  border: 3px solid #3988E7;
  width: 360px;
  height: 290px;
  float: left;
  margin-top: 26px;
  background: #3988E7;
}
/*左边头部*/
.two-up-left-div-header {
  width: 317px;
  height: 70px;
  background: #3988E7;
  line-height: 70px;
  margin-left: 15px;
}

.two-up-left-div-up {
  padding: 8px 0px 4px 8px;
  font-size: 15px;
  font-family: 微软雅黑;
  transform: translate(5px, -28px);
  width: 345px;
  height: 220px;
  line-height: 40px;
  background: white;
}
/*中间*/
.two-up-center-div {
  border: 3px solid #3988E7;
  width: 360px;
  height: 290px;
  float: left;
  margin-top: 26px;
  background: #3988E7;

  margin-left: 40px;
  margin-bottom: 30px;
}
.two-up-center-div-header {
  width: 317px;
  height: 70px;
  background: #3988E7;
  line-height: 70px;
  margin-left: 15px;
}
.two-up-center-div-up {
  padding: 8px 0px 4px 8px;
  font-size: 15px;
  transform: translate(5px, -28px);
  width: 345px;
  height: 220px;
  line-height: 40px;
  background: white;
}
/*右边*/
.two-up-right-div {
  border: 3px solid #3988E7;

  width: 360px;
  height: 290px;
  float: left;
  margin-top: 26px;
  background: #3988E7;
  margin-left: 40px;
}
/*右边头部*/
.two-up-right-div-header {
  width: 317px;
  height: 70px;
  background: #3988E7;
  line-height: 70px;
  margin-left: 15px;

}

.two-up-right-div-up {
  font-size: 15px;
  padding: 8px 0px 4px 8px;
  transform: translate(5px, -28px);
  width: 345px;
  height: 220px;
  line-height: 40px;
  background: white;
}


.four {

  margin: 0;
  width: 100%;
  height: 100%;
}

.five {
  margin: 0;
  width: 100%;
  /*height: 542px;*/
  height: 100%;
}

.six {
  margin: 0;
  width: 100%;
  /*height: 464px;*/
  height: 100%;
}

.seven {
  margin: 0;
  width: 100%;
  /*height: 160px;*/
  height: 100%;
}

.banner2 {
  margin: 0;
  width: 100%;
  /*height: 513px;*/
  height: 100%;
}

.eight {
  margin: 0;
  width: 100%;
  height: 12.5%;
  background-color: #F6F6F6;
  float: left;

}

.eight-left-pic {
  width: 50%;
  height: 100%;
  float: left;
}

.eight-right {
  width: 50%;
  height: 100%;
  float: right;
  background-color:#F6F6F6;

}


.font-contact-method {
  float: left;
  margin-top: 15%;
  font-size: 2vw;
  font-family: 宋体 Serif;
  color: #3988E7;
  width: 30%;
  float: left;

}

.font-contact-phone {
  width:100%;
  height: 5%;
  margin-top: 4%;

  float: left;

}

.font-contact-email {
  width: 100%;
  height: 5%;
  margin-top: 3%;
  float: left;
}

.font-contact-address {
  float: left;
  width: 100%;
  height: 5%;
  margin-top:2%;



}

.phone {

  width: 5%;
  height:100%;
  float: left;
}

.email {
  width: 5%;
  height: 100%;
  float: left;
}

.address {
  width: 5%;
  height: 100%;
  float: left;

}

.phone-font {
  font-size:1.3vw;
  margin-top: 1%;
  height: 6%;
  width: 50%;
  float: left;
  margin-left:2%;

}

.email-font {
  font-size: 1.3vw;
  height: 5%;
  width: 50%;
  float: left;
  margin-left:2%;
  margin-top: 1%;
  margin-bottom: 1%;

}

.address-font {

  font-size: 1.3vw;
  height: 100%;
  width: 93%;
  float: left;
  margin-top: 1%;
  margin-left: 2%;

}
